Definition 1 of 2
Definition
The tendency of a spinning rotor (such as a gyroscope) to respond to an applied force as if that force had been applied at a point 90 degrees later in the direction of rotation. In aviation gyroscopic instruments, precession also refers to the gradual drift of the gyro away from its set reference, requiring periodic correction.
Plain English
When you push on a spinning wheel, it doesn't tilt where you pushed it — it tilts at a point a quarter-turn further around in the direction it's spinning. In gyro instruments, precession is also the slow wandering of the indication over time, which is why pilots have to reset them.

Derivation
From Latin praecedere, 'to go before.' The spinning rotor's reaction appears 'ahead' of where the force was applied — the effect shows up further along in the direction of spin rather than at the point of contact.
Why Pilots Care
Explains why a propeller airplane yaws left on takeoff and why attitude indicators show a slight lag or error when the airplane is turned quickly.

Intuition Check
Do not assume the force acts only at the exact place it is applied. With precession, the main turning effect appears about 90 degrees later in the direction the object is spinning.
